DIY Zoom Lens for Your Camera Phone

3 Comments | This entry was posted on Jan 06 2009

One of the Christmas gifts to the family was a pair of binoculars for each of us. We intend to use them on our trips to Paynes Prairie and other nature spots around town. We took them to a recent trip to the park to look at the birds and squirrels in the pine trees, when I was suddenly struck by the idea of shooting through them.

The process is simple. Point binoculars at subject. Focus on subject. Line up camera phone lens with either side of the binoculars and then shoot. The results are interesting and even a bit voyeuristic, but with a little more experimenting, I might be able to pull something worthwhile together. In the meantime, here’s a sample of the results.
